Full breach record for Native Canada Footwear Ltd

Native Canada Footwear, Ltd. disclosed a malware attack on its website (nativeshoes.com) that potentially compromised payment card information (Visa/Mastercard) and personal data (name, address, email, phone) of customers who made purchases between April 28, 2015, and June 23, 2017. The company became aware of the vulnerability in late June 2017. Affected individuals were offered one year of credit monitoring. The incident did not affect PayPal transactions or purchases made through online partners or brick-and-mortar stores.
